The Amazon pellona is one of the few species Pristigasteridae with recognized commercial value in Amazon.We isolated 24 and characterized 8 microsatellite loci for this species.The number alleles ranges from 2-8 per locus.Observed heterozygosities ranged 0.052-0.823,while expected 0.052-0.836.These microsatellites are potentially valuable tools characterizing levels distribution genetic diversity, population structure, gene flow.They may also be important parameters conservation species, as...

This note demonstrates the use of a DNA barcoding methodology in confirming new occurrence records Pellona castelnaeana and flavipinnis Branco River sub-basin. The barcode result was verified by identification based on morphological characters both species. Thus, these increase species’ ranges more than 600 km Amazon show evidence high genetic variability P. flavipinnis.
